1. Where existing parkway trees have been root pruned, install continuous,
lineal root barrier adjacent to the pipe.
2. Root sealer shall be applied to all cut root areas which are larger that 2" in
10' or less
diameter. The sealer shall be applied as soon as practical after the cuts have
1'
Curb been made. Root sealer shall be approved by the engineer at least 48 hours
in advance of the pruning operation.
3. Root barriers shall be fabricated from a high density, high impact plastic or hot
dipped galvanized steel.
